UCP Uyumlu Protokoller
UCP, endüstri standartları üzerine inşa edilmiştir. AP2, A2A, MCP, REST API ve JSON-RPC ile farklı sistemler özel entegrasyon yazmadan birlikte çalışabilir.
Agent Payments Protocol (AP2)
AP2, yapay zeka ajanları ve uygulamaları için güvenli ödeme akışlarını standartlaştıran bir protokoldür. UCP, AP2 ile entegre çalışarak ödeme mandatları ve doğrulanabilir kimlik bilgileri (verifiable credentials) ile her ödeme yetkilendirmesinin kullanıcı onayının kriptografik kanıtıyla desteklenmesini sağlar. Bu sayede ajan tabanlı alışverişte ödeme güvenliği kanıtlanabilir düzeyde olur. Açık ve modüler ödeme işleyici (payment handler) tasarımı, sağlayıcılar arasında birlikte çalışabilirlik ve alıcıların tercih ettikleri ödeme yöntemiyle ödeme yapabilmesini hedefler.
Agent2Agent (A2A)
A2A, yapay zeka ajanlarının birbirleriyle doğrudan iletişim kurmasını sağlayan bir protokoldür. Çoklu ajan senaryoları, otonom ticaret akışları ve karmaşık iş süreçlerinde ajanların eşgüdümlü çalışmasını destekler. UCP, A2A ile uyumlu olarak ajanların satıcı ve ödeme sağlayıcılarıyla birlikte çalışmasını; örneğin bir alışveriş ajanının fiyat karşılaştırma ajanı ile koordineli satın alma yapmasını mümkün kılar. A2A binding sayesinde UCP ilkelleri (checkout, sipariş vb.) ajan dili ile ifade edilebilir.
Model Context Protocol (MCP)
MCP, büyük dil modelleri (LLM) ve uygulamalar arasında bağlam paylaşımı sağlayan bir protokoldür. UCP, MCP binding ile mevcut ajan çerçevelerine sorunsuz entegrasyon sunar. Bu sayede bir LLM tabanlı asistan, kullanıcının konuşma bağlamını koruyarak UCP üzerinden checkout başlatabilir, sipariş sorgulayabilir veya iade işlemi yapabilir. MCP uyumluluğu, UCP'nin yalnızca klasik API çağrılarıyla değil; doğal dil etkileşimleri içinden de kullanılabilmesini sağlar.
REST API ve JSON-RPC
UCP, standart REST API ve JSON-RPC taşımalarını destekler. Bu sayede her programlama dili ve platformdan erişim mümkün olur. Checkout, Identity Linking ve Order gibi çekirdek yetenekler REST uç noktaları üzerinden kullanılabilir; JSON-RPC ise daha hafif ve hızlı mesajlaşma gerektiren senaryolar için alternatif sunar. Ayrıca native SDK'lar farklı dil bağlamaları ile UCP entegrasyonunu hızlandırır ve geliştiricilerin mevcut geliştirme ortamlarında kolayca çalışmasını sağlar.
Adaptörler ve Uyumluluk
Farklı bir protokol kullanıyorsanız, UCP uyumluluk için adaptörler sunar. UCP ilkelleri checkout gibi standart perakende işlemleriyle bire bir eşlenir; bu sayede mevcut iş mantığınızla düşük yük ile hizalanmış entegrasyon hedeflenir. İşletmeler desteklemek istedikleri yetenek setini ve iletişim ortamını (API, MCP veya A2A) seçebilir.
Neden Önemli?
Ajan tabanlı ticaret, farklı sistemler arasında birlikte çalışabilirlik gerektirir. UCP'nin AP2, A2A, MCP, REST ve JSON-RPC gibi endüstri standartlarıyla uyumlu olması; her platform, ajan ve işletmenin özel entegrasyon yazmadan aynı dil üzerinden ticaret yapabilmesi anlamına gelir. Bu, hem entegrasyon maliyetlerini düşürür hem de ekosistemdeki tüm oyuncuların daha hızlı ve güvenli şekilde bağlanmasını sağlar.
Güvenlik ve Ödeme, Ekosistem ve UCP Rehberi sayfalarımızı inceleyebilirsiniz. Entegrasyon hizmeti için iletişim sayfamızdan bize ulaşabilirsiniz. ucpentegrasyon.com ve ucpseo.net adreslerimizden de UCP hizmetlerine ulaşabilirsiniz.